Melodically I quite liked it. Especially when the full piano type melody kicks in after the break. A little too familiar perhaps but I did like it nonetheless.

Other aspects of the track were solid enough but in a very generic way. Nothing I haven't heard before numerous times over. Personally I'd have prefered a few surprises regarding percs, synth sounds, automation. Instead I found much of it very typical and standard if you know what I mean.

Won't bother commenting on mixdown if this isnt the finished mix.

Anyway, like I say, I did quite like the melody which I understand was what your main aim with this rework was.

With a bit more work, this track would stand up against many other trance tunes. But I don't think it would stick out from the herd in anyway.

Technically you've improved a lot from what I heard when you first arrived at this forum
